The grade I obtain, is a combination of how bad do I want/need it, the cost, and the rarity. Sometimes a grade 6 or 7 will have to do. For a rare card, sometimes a grade 2 is satisfactory. Especially if there only a dozen or so floating around. I may never see it again, if I don't get the 2. I try to stay in the grade 7 range. Nice cards, but they don't break the bank. Many times, the price differential between a 7 and an 8, doesn't justify tying up all that cash. A 51 Bowman mantle grade 6 ran me $4500. A 7 would have been around $9500. I can't justify that. i am a collector, not an investor. But I TRY to stay in the 7 range.
